President Cyril Ramaphosa’s cabinet has actually extended South Africa’s nationwide state of catastrophe, however states that work is now being done to bring it to a close next month.

This follows a rundown by the National Joint Operational and Intelligence Structure (Natjoints) recently to figure out the degree to which the management of the Covid-19 pandemic still needed the presence of the state of catastrophe.

” Inputs were gotten from different federal government departments to identify their particular locations of work that are at a sophisticated phase of conclusion,” Cabinet stated.

” After keeping in mind that a few of the crucial departments handling Covid-19 had not yet concluded their analysis, Cabinet authorized the last extension of the National State of Disaster to 15 March 2022, in regards to Section 27( 5 )( c) of the Disaster Management Act.”

In his state of the country address on Thursday night (10 February), the president stated that completion to the state of catastrophe will be settled as soon as brand-new policies beyond the Disaster Management Act are total.

He kept in mind that South Africa has actually now raised almost all financial and social limitations which the nation was now going into a ‘brand-new stage of the pandemic’.

” Our method has actually been notified throughout by the finest offered clinical proof, and we have actually stood apart both for the quality of our researchers and for their participation in every action of our action.

” We are now all set to get in a brand-new stage in our management of the pandemic. It is my intent to end the nationwide state of catastrophe as quickly as we have actually settled other steps under the National Health Act and other legislation to include the pandemic.”

The state of catastrophe is presently set to end on 15 March 2022 following the current extension. This would make it the 23rd month under the state of catastrophe considering that it was stated at the end of March 2020, and the 20th extension of the policies after their very first end date of June 2020.

The act offers that it can be extended by the Cooperative Governance and Traditional Affairs minister for one month at a time prior to it lapses. The federal government has actually depended on the guidelines to present and offer result to lockdown limitations, which it has actually utilized to suppress the spread of the Covid-19 pandemic.

Nevertheless, it has actually likewise dealt with criticism for providing nationwide federal government comprehensive powers over the lives of residents, with couple of limitations and little to no oversight from parliament.
